On one end of the electromagnetic spectrum are radio waves, which have wavelengths billions of times longer than those of visible light. Electromagnetic spectrum, the entire distribution of electromagnetic radiation according to frequency or wavelength.Although all electromagnetic waves travel at the speed of light in a vacuum, they do so at a wide range of frequencies, wavelengths, and photon energies.
